Rad-Hard, 5.0V/3.3V µ-Processor Supervisory Circuits
ISL705ARH, ISL705BRH, ISL705CRH, ISL706ARH, ISL706BRH, ISL706CRH
This family of devices are radiation hardened 5.0V/3.3V
supervisory circuits that reduce the complexity required to
monitor supply voltages in microprocessor systems. These
devices significantly improve accuracy and reliability relative to
discrete solutions. Each IC provides four key functions.
1. A reset output during power-up, power-down, and brownout
conditions.
2. An independent watchdog output that goes low if the
watchdog input has not been toggled within 1.6s.
3. A precision threshold detector for monitoring a power
supply other than VDD.
4. An active-low manual-reset input.

Features
• Electrically Screened to SMD 5962-11213
• QML Qualified per MIL-PRF-38535 Requirements
• Radiation Hardness
- High Dose Rate. . . . . . . . . . . . . . . . . . . . . . . . . . 100krad(Si)
- SEL/SEB LETTH. . . . . . . . . . . . . . . . . . . . . . 86MeV/mg/cm2
• Precision Supply Voltage Monitor
- 4.65V Threshold in the ISL705ARH/BRH/CRH
- 3.08V Threshold in the ISL706ARH/BRH/CRH
• 200ms (Typ) Reset Pulse Width
- Active High, Active Low and Open Drain Options
• Independent Watchdog Timer with 1.6s (Typ) Timeout
• Precision Threshold Detector
- 1.25V Threshold in the ISL705ARH/BRH/CRH
- 0.6V Threshold in the ISL706ARH/BRH/CRH
• Debounced TTL/CMOS Compatible Manual-Reset Input
• Reset Output Valid at VDD = 1.2V
